5 Questions to Ask When Buying a Commercial Dehumidifier

Inofia 232 Pints 29 Gallons Large CapacityThe interesting array of commercial dehumidifiers out there can make it more difficult to narrow down your choices to just one. You can try asking the following questions, so you can identify the commercial dehumidifier that will truly work for your specific needs:

1. How much molds and moisture problem am I dealing with?

In order to identify the capacity of the commercial dehumidifier you should purchase, first determine just how big molds and moisture problem you have in your commercial space. How big is the square footage of the space? Where is it located and what is causing the excess moisture problem to begin with? These are the things you need to consider, so you can determine the size of a commercial dehumidifier to buy.

2. Do I need something that I can put in place or one that can be fixed on a wall?

You basically have two options when it comes to commercial dehumidifiers. It’s either you go for something that you can mount or something that you can still move. There are portable commercial dehumidifiers out there with casters and a handle that you can use to move the unit around. Which one you should buy still depends on your personal preferences. If you have moisture issues in different parts of the building, a movable one might come handy. If you only have moisture problems in the basement, then stick to one that can be fixed in this space.

3. What humidity range is the best in this room?

Some humidity is still good. A dehumidifier can be set, so it can control the humidity levels in the room. Just make sure you know what humidity range is ideal and look for a commercial dehumidifier that can provide that.

4. Is noise going to be an issue?

Dehumidifiers can get noisy. A big one can emit a loud and annoying sound that can interrupt your daily operations. If it is in an isolated place in the building, this might not be a concern but if you are going to install it right next to where your employees are working, it can be disrupting.

5. Are there issues about installation?

Will something impede the installation of a drain hose? Identify all possible issues first, so you can make a concrete plan on proper installation.

Factors to Consider in Buying the Best Commercial Dehumidifier

To make sure that you are truly buying the best commercial dehumidifier, use these factors to guide you in the right direction:

1. Capacity

BlueDri Compact Low Grain Efficient CommercialThe first thing you should do is determine the capacity of dehumidifier you need. Now this will depend on the level of moisture in the space you intend to place it. If the room only gets occasionally damp, one with 40 pints of capacity might suffice. If you can see visible condensation on windows and you frequently have issues with molds, one with 60 pints of capacity and above is a better choice.

2. Noise

Noise can be a major concern when it comes to dehumidifiers. Many manufacturers divulge details on the noise level that their dehumidifiers emit. You can use that to compare how noisy the machine is with other machines and determine whether it is going to be a good fit for your home.

3. Energy Consumption

Compare energy consumption as well. Since commercial dehumidifiers are bigger, they will also inadvertently consume more energy. More energy consumption means higher energy bills. Compare energy efficiency and determine if the one you are buying has energy-saving features.

4. Installation

How are you going to install the unit? Is it a kind of plug and play device? In most cases, you will need to connect it to a drain hose and direct it to an available drain, so you no longer have to remove the contents of the water reservoir. This is a more convenient set-up for a commercial space.

5. Price

Set aside a budget for a commercial dehumidifier and look for those that fit your budget range. Make sure you are reasonable about your budget range and you choose products that won’t cause you to go out of your budget but still has the features you are looking for.
